Welcome to the Uisce Éireann Transformation Programme website.

As we enter the final year of the Uisce Éireann Transformation Programme (UÉTP), our focus is on completing the integration that will bring together a unified water services organisation built for the future. This transformation is creating a modern, efficient, and innovative organisation that will deliver improved services, stronger capability, and meaningful career opportunities for staff.

In 2025 the Uisce Éireann Transformation Programme team met with colleagues across the country to provide updates on our transformation journey—what’s happening now and what’s planned for the rest of the Framework period. These sessions outlined a clear picture of the new national structure for Asset Operations and what it means for their local water services area. Colleagues were also able to gain insight into new Ways of Working, what training is available to them and were offered a one-to-one consultation with a member of the HR team. For those considering a move to Uisce Éireann, these engagements offered a chance to begin the transfer process and take the next step in their career within our growing, national organisation. How the HR One to One meeting will work

These meetings are being held locally and virtually via Zoom in each Local Authority area. Once you submit your Request for Information, we send you an email requesting you to compile your Details of Employment with the Local Authority, i.e. your current salary, grade, overtime, allowances, and all existing agreements in place with your employer. Only information provided by you will be used for the discussion.

We will be able to provide a comparison between the Uisce Éireann pay model and the mirrored LA pay model based on the information you supply. An Uisce Éireann HR representative will then go through all your information with you and confirm the guarantees in relation to your existing terms and conditions, as well as answer any individual questions you may have in relation to transferring to Uisce Éireann.

Following on from this meeting, you can confirm your intention to transfer to Uisce Éireann and we will follow up with formal contract information. You can also decide not to join at this time and consider all your options further before deciding to transfer later. All staff in water services will have the option to join Uisce Éireann up to the end of 2026.
